Key Services to Look For

When evaluating web development agencies in Seattle, it’s essential to identify what services align with your organization’s goals and needs. Here are some critical services to consider:

  • Custom Web Design: A specialized focus on creating visually appealing and user-friendly designs that resonate with your audience.
  • Content Management Systems (CMS): Expertise in popular platforms like WordPress, Drupal, Webflow, and Shopify. This includes custom theme and plugin development tailored to your specific business needs.
  • Accessibility Compliance: Ensuring that your website meets standards like WCAG 2.1 AA and Section 508, making it accessible for all users, which is increasingly important for public sector and educational institutions.
  • Ongoing SEO and AI Visibility: Proficient agencies will provide SEO strategies that enhance your visibility on search engines, supported by AI technologies for continuous optimization.
  • Technical Support and Training: Post-launch support should include training for your team, ensuring they can effectively manage and update the website as needed.

Common Mistakes in Service Selection

Choosing a web development agency can be complex, and it’s easy to make missteps. Here are some common mistakes to avoid:

  • Overlooking Portfolio: An agency's portfolio reflects its capabilities. Failing to review past projects could lead to a mismatch between your expectations and the agency's expertise.
  • Ignoring User Experience (UX): Agencies that focus solely on aesthetics without prioritizing user experience may lead to high bounce rates and low engagement.
  • Not Considering Scalability: Consider whether the agency's solutions can scale with your institution's growth. A lack of future-proofing can lead to costly redesigns later.
  • Neglecting Accessibility Needs: Ensure the agency understands the importance of web accessibility and can demonstrate compliance with standards.
  • Failure to Establish Clear Communication: Effective communication before and during the project is crucial for staying aligned and meeting deadlines.

How to Make the Right Choice

Choosing the right web development agency involves thorough research and consideration of several factors:

  • Define Your Goals: Clearly outline what you intend to achieve with your website. This will help you communicate effectively with potential agencies.
  • Request Proposals: Solicit proposals from several agencies, evaluating them based not only on services but also on their ability to meet your stated objectives.
  • Assess Experience and Expertise: Look for agencies with specific experience relevant to your industry, especially those familiar with higher education or public sector projects.
  • Follow Up with References: Reach out to past clients to gain insights into their experiences and the outcomes achieved.
  • Evaluate Cultural Fit: Cultural alignment between your organization and the agency can significantly influence project success.
